My highlight of my weekend was to be trip out to Pasadena for the Doo Dah Parade . Every year I miss it for one reason or another, grr. The best thing about this parade is that for ten bucks you can be in it to do almost whatever wackiness you like showing off. Over 1,500 participants in over 100 ‘marching groups will appear in Doo Dah’s 29th occasional event this fall. America’s favorite “other parade,” known for its colorful and irreverent satire is a spoof on the New Year’s Day Rose Parade. 45,000 typically attend the annual pre-Thanksgiving event, which was named by The Reader’s Digest as the Best Parade in 2004. Towers, farm seen for Treasure Island Self-sustaining neighborhood of 5,500 residences proposed from sfgate.com Some of you know about my fascination for Treasure Island in the middle of SF bay, and the new development plan released today gets a big whoa from me. Originally there were to be @ 2500 new residents, but now they are planning mutiple 20 story and a couple 40 + stories residential units on the west side of the island. This is good thing actually. The City of SF is going develop it regardless and they really need to develop the fuck out of it with the proposed 5500 housing units, a new ferry terminal, along with a 20 acre farm to make it as self suffcient as possible. The article link above gives a better overview. I would still have to win the lottery to afford even the 30% percent of units sold or rented below market rates and that's a sad reality.
